im sure this wont be the only contest they hold, dip your toes into blender, and a paint program. Watch a few hours of video tutorials on skinning, and texturing. Blender is really easy to use and pretty easy to pick up once u learn most the shortcuts. Good luck to all the new people in 3d art.

Sure thing. I need to try and use blender. I had a pretty bad experience with it, when I was first thought how to use it, I was really young. I never really managed to get it working the way I would have wanted and it frustrated me so much, that it sort of turned me off of digital art. I'll need to give it another shot.

Here's my entry. This was my first time ever using Photoshop and Blender. I learned a lot. I'm quite proud of the custom Kubrow design I made from scratch, I've never done anything like that before.

 

 

BR9M0p3.jpg

 

The lines around the Kubrow and the claw marks will glow the same color as the chosen energy color, giving off a sweet neon outline look.

The skin is fully tintable, I added a new tint channel for the Kubrow and the claw marks (used the unused tint channel in the file).

I made this the other day, never done anything like this before but I thought it would be fun. The akmagnus has long been my favorite secondary and some of the submissions are really awesome but here's mine anyway >_>

 

The Kubrows along the barrel and the Symbol on the handle should glow with your energy color. The celtic design on the bullet chamber uses the same primary color as the basic magnus. The engraving designs are fairly typical when I was looking for pictures of engraved pistols and revolvers and they use the 4th tint color that is unused by the default magnus.

 

I lol'd when I saw the last guy posted a kubrow themed magnus too -_-.

 

Oh BTW the symbol on the handle is a Japanese symbol for Ninja.
